Box Office Results: Smile Continues Reign While Lyle, Lyle Crocodile & Amsterdam Disappoint
According to Deadline, Smile maintained an outstanding second weekend gross of $17.6 million, a 22% drop from its first weekend. After Jordan Peele’s Get Out, the Park Finn movie earned the distinction of having the “second-best hold ever for an R-rated horror movie” with that sum.
The horror film from Paramount has made $50 million domestically. Smiling its way to a remarkable $90 million global gain, Smile has amassed $40 million from 61 markets worldwide.
The family movie Lyle, Lyle Crocodile, on the other hand, only made $11.5 million from 4,350 theaters since it wasn’t funny enough to lure large audiences. A star-studded comedy by David O’Russell called Amsterdam underperformed with $6.5 million from 3,005 screenings.
